There was a thread awhile back about unusual arpeggiators which turned me on to Tonecarver's Nova3, a generative sequencer. It's not at all like typical arps, but given that Live's arp is (in my experience from Live
a great typical arp, and you're finding it too basic, maybe you want something different. Nova can do all the usual fixed sequences, as well as evolving sequences, random-sounding sequences, and chord sequences. You have to think a little differently and use automation cleverly or record its output, but I find Nova a lot of fun.
